  • Publication number: 20070032230
    Abstract: When a first communication unit (204) receives a request from a second communication unit (102) (over an ad hoc network) to relay a call, the first communication unit will start a data call (e.g., voice over IP call) over the cellular link using the cellular phone's data capability. Since, for billing and authentication purposes, this call should be billed to the second communication unit, the cellular phone call is not set up using the standard call setup procedure (i.e. Destination phone number from the second communication unit and Originating phone number from the first communication unit). Instead, the call is setup as a “free” phone call from a first communication unit to a predefined, free number. The relay passes through the cellular link as data in the form of a data call (e.g., VoIP call). The cellular infrastructure would then route the call to its final destination.

  • Patent number: 6097953
    Abstract: The present invention provides a method for determining whether to handoff in a wireless communication system (100). The system (100) collects first environmental variables related to a first mobile station (105) within the wireless communication system (100). The system (100) determines when a communication between a base station (101) and the first mobile station (105) is improperly terminated. The system (100) analyzes, when the communication is improperly terminated, the first environmental variables to generate environmental conditions rules. The system (100) then applies the environmental conditions rules to a second mobile station (106) which subsequently communicates with the base station (101) and which has second environment variables substantially similar to the first environmental variables.
